Wire
https://wire.com/
Modern communication tool, full privacy.
Depends on Electron and has trademark policies and licensing restrictions related to server interaction and software behavior that interfere with software freedom. Adfeno (talk) 08:56, 31 March 2020 (EDT)
Wire is a modern communication tool with full end-to-end encryption. Its current features are audio conferencing with up to 10 people, and 1-to-1 video conferences, as well as other minor features.
